A capacitance of 2.0 `mu F ` is required in an electrical circult across a potential difference of 1.0 kV . A large number of `1 mu F ` capacitors are available which can withstand a potential difference of not more than 300 V . the minimum number of capacitors required to achieve this is

A

`2`

B

`16`

C

`24`

D

`32`
